Things You Need To Know About Credit Cards and Dining Out

If you use credit cards when you go out to eat, you might want to rethink how you pay for your meals. Recently making headlines was a news story that highlighted the fact that restaurants don’t always follow the specific security procedures they are required to comply with when processing credit card payments from their customers. Below you’ll learn more about potential dangers of using your credit cards.

Would You Like Security Breaches With Your Steak, Sir?

How often do you go out to eat? Do you always pay with a credit card? Credit card fraud does occur, and it’s not always easy to determine just how much credit card fraud involves transactions that occurred at restaurants.

One problem that was mentioned in a recent news article involved security issues. If restaurants don’t follow strict security guidelines, it is possible for a criminal using a laptop in the restaurant parking lot to intercept data.

It’s always important to double check your credit card statements, but if you frequently use your credit card to pay for restaurant meals, you might want to pay particular attention to your credit card statements.

Diligence Pays

It’s not necessary to avoid using your credit cards when you go to a restaurant, but if you do read a news story about security issues at businesses in your area then it might be wise to avoid using your credit cards at those businesses until they’ve had time to resolve those issues.

Always cross-reference your receipts with your credit card statements. Make sure that the amount on each receipt is equal to what has posted to your credit card statement. Always check your credit card statements for unusual charges as well and immediately notify your credit card company of any activity that you didn’t authorize.
